What is it?

Executive dysfunction is a breakdown in the management system of your brain. It makes it hard to start tasks, stay organized, and manage time. For a mom, this means the constant flow of chores and schedules can feel overwhelming.

Signs & Symptoms

Feeling paralyzed when the house is messy
Struggling to decide what to make for dinner
Forgetting school events or permission slips
Losing your keys or phone several times a day

Why does this happen?

Your prefrontal cortex acts like a CEO for your brain. In ADHD brains, this CEO has a hard time getting enough dopamine to stay focused. This makes it very difficult to switch between playing with your kids and doing the laundry. Your brain gets stuck in a loop because it cannot decide which task is the most important.
